加入收藏 | 设为首页 | 会员中心 | 我要投稿 站长网 (https://www.0951zz.com/)- 云通信、基础存储、云上网络、机器学习、视觉智能!
当前位置: 首页 > 服务器 > 搭建环境 > Unix > 正文

Unix高效后端开发环境搭建:软件包管理速成指南

发布时间:2026-04-02 12:40:07 所属栏目:Unix 来源:DaWei
导读:  在Unix系统上搭建高效的后端开发环境,软件包管理是关键步骤之一。选择合适的包管理器可以大幅提升开发效率,减少依赖冲突和版本问题。  常见的Unix系统如Linux和macOS,各自有不同的包管理工具。例如,Debian

  在Unix系统上搭建高效的后端开发环境,软件包管理是关键步骤之一。选择合适的包管理器可以大幅提升开发效率,减少依赖冲突和版本问题。


  常见的Unix系统如Linux和macOS,各自有不同的包管理工具。例如,Debian/Ubuntu系统使用APT,Red Hat/CentOS使用YUM或DNF,而macOS则常用Homebrew。了解这些工具的基本命令是入门的第一步。


  安装软件时,建议优先通过包管理器获取预编译的二进制包,这样可以避免手动编译带来的复杂性。大多数开发所需的工具链,如GCC、Python、Java等,都可以直接通过包管理器安装。


  对于需要特定版本的软件,包管理器通常也提供多个版本的选择。例如,在Ubuntu中可以通过添加PPA源来获取更新的软件版本。同时,使用虚拟环境或容器技术(如Docker)可以进一步隔离不同项目的依赖。


  定期更新包列表和已安装的软件是保持系统安全和稳定的必要操作。使用`apt update`或`brew update`等命令可以确保获取最新的软件信息。


  掌握包管理器的搜索、查找和卸载功能,能帮助开发者更高效地管理依赖关系。例如,使用`apt search`或`brew search`可以快速定位所需软件。


本图由AI生成,仅供参考

  合理的软件包管理策略,不仅能提升开发效率,还能减少因依赖问题导致的调试时间。熟练掌握这些工具,是成为一名高效Unix后端开发者的重要一步。

(编辑:站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章